Bug#491973: xvnc4viewer: xvncviewer doesn't exit gracefuly when you press ctrl+c on password entering

2008-07-24 Thread Ola Lundqvist
severity 491973 wishlist thanks Hi This is a common problem in many applications. The reason is that Ctrl+C is not catched and therefore the terminal is not set back. I'll make this a wishlist problem. Thanks for the report. Best regards, // Ola On Wed, Jul 23, 2008 at 07:51:49AM +1000,
